Sir Alex Ferguson´s Manchester United squad prepare for their third match of their pre-season tour of South Africa and China as The Reds take on Shanghai Shenhua at the Shanghai Stadium on Wednesday. The Shanghai Stadium has a crowd capacity of around 80,000 people and is one of the thirty largest soccer stadiums in the world.
Shanghai Shenhua are playing in the Chinese Super League and have won two Chinese League Championships and one Chinese FA Cup. The ambitious club are managed by previous Argentina manager Sergio Batista and currently sit at twelfth place in the Super League.
